MOOCs and Open Education Around the World. Routledge 2015.
Edited by Curtis J. Bonk, Mimi M. Lee, Thomas C. Reeves, Thomas H. Reynolds.

MOOCs and Open Education is a
book
that
examines
topics
relating to open
education resources
and
massively open online courses (MOOC).
The latest
advancements in
online education enable
people
in nations all aver the world
to be participants in classes via the Internet.
These massively open online courses are
customarily free
for students but do not
lead to formal accreditation.
There are several
topics that
online learning technology institutions
have to consider
more than ever because blended learning technology is
developing so swiftly.
How can stakeholders
certify that
the training provided by these
massively open online courses is
passable?
How can learners
guarantee that
instructors are properly credentialed
and qualified to teach MOOC classes?
What different business strategies are being used by
institutions like
Stanford University to conduct these massively open online courses?
What experimental evaluation strategies and teaching practices are optimal?
How can stakeholders
manage
poor
student motivation and high
attrition?
As electronic education technology becomes more
procurable there is a
need
to be aware of how
these MOOC classes are being conducted.
Corporations
and lots of other
participants
need
to better grasp
these
fascinating new open education
initiatives.
Intellectuals want
to understand how
these MOOC classes
can be made better.
To respond to this
expanding
need for
information
the new book
MOOCs and Open Education Around the World
offers a critical analysis of
these online MOOCs and other open educational resource issues.
This interesting new book
also articulates the
key controversies associated with
massively open online courses and open educational resources (OER).
